Output 6f56527d81af7aa0c03373f14462ea9948798b087b21d4a591ea5e3877799b13:0

value
29000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9537d7efd45c8f0ffff7c67b91f0dce5fb86696 OP_EQUAL
address
3MW8aAzSwh8fPXDKgab3fzmFSWuEbYBv5F
transaction
6f56527d81af7aa0c03373f14462ea9948798b087b21d4a591ea5e3877799b13
spent
true